Mayor Launches Healthy Eating Cookbook

Pupils from schools across Harrow in north London have teamed up with children from a school in India to launch a healthy eating cookbook with a distinctly international flavour.

Using produce grown in their own school gardens, junior masterchefs from four Harrow schools and another in Kolkata competed to include their recipes in the culinary guide.

The Mayor of Harrow, Cllr Asad Omar, will taste a selection of the winning 23 dishes during a book launch at Canons High School on Wednesday 16th June. The easy-to-follow book features soups, curries and cakes, along with burritos and a Jamaican salmon dish, all cooked by pupils aged five to 13 years old.

The book launch celebrates the end of a British Council backed project to teach children about healthy eating, the environment and eco-awareness. Pupils from Canons High School , Stag Lane Middle, Stag Lane First and Glebe First & Middle school, all in Harrow , took part, along with children at Gokhale Memorial Girls' School in Kolkata.
